3 votos

Iniciando en la recuperación personalizada con un cargador de arranque bloqueado

Estoy planeando instalar una ROM personalizada en mi dispositivo, pero soy demasiado perezoso para hacer copias de seguridad. Mi herramienta de copia de seguridad favorita es Titanium Backup, así que quiero acceso root en mi dispositivo antes de desbloquear el gestor de arranque. Pero desafortunadamente, para instalar el archivo SuperSU necesito tener un recovery personalizado en mi dispositivo, ya que mi recovery de fábrica no me permite instalar SuperSU zip. Y para instalar un recovery personalizado necesito desbloquear el gestor de arranque. ¿Puedo, sin embargo, arrancar en el recovery Team Win sin desbloquear el gestor de arranque con este comando?

fastboot boot twrp.img

Esto me permitirá rootear mi dispositivo y hacer copias de seguridad fácilmente antes de desbloquear el gestor de arranque del dispositivo. ¿Es seguro para mí hacerlo de esta manera?

0 votos

Solo un pequeño detalle, si logras rootear tu teléfono sin desbloquearlo, entonces probablemente no necesitarás desbloquearlo para instalar una recuperación personalizada/ROM tampoco.

0 votos

Tienes razón. Podría usar Flashify para flashear TWRP pero no lo haré ya que el flasheo a través de fastboot tiene su propia esencia y diversión.

0 votos

No puedes fastboot boot con una imagen personalizada y un gestor de arranque bloqueado, al menos en mi Nexus 6P, 7.1.1.

3voto

Hunter Puntos 434

Tl;dr

No, no puedes usar fastboot boot para arrancar en una recuperación personalizada si el gestor de arranque está bloqueado (como señaló Jerry Chin en un comentario).

Respuesta más larga

Android Security Internals dice en Capítulo 13: Actualizaciones del sistema y Acceso Root (en la sección Recuperación, subsección Recuperaciones Personalizadas):

Una recuperación personalizada es una construcción de sistema operativo de recuperación creada por un tercero (no por el fabricante del dispositivo). Debido a que es creada por un tercero, una recuperación personalizada no está firmada con las claves del fabricante, por lo tanto, el gestor de arranque del dispositivo necesita estar desbloqueado para poder arrancar o flashear en ella.

Y en el Capítulo 10: Seguridad del Dispositivo (en la sección Controlando el Arranque del Sistema e Instalación, subsección Gestor de Arranque):

Con el fin de garantizar la integridad del dispositivo, los dispositivos de consumo se envían con gestores de arranque bloqueados, que o bien no permiten el flasheo y el arranque de imágenes de sistema por completo o solamente permiten hacerlo para imágenes que hayan sido firmadas por el fabricante del dispositivo.

Por lo tanto, si intentas usar fastboot boot twrp.img, el gestor de arranque descubrirá que twrp.img no está firmado con la clave del fabricante, y se negará a arrancar en ella.

Y en caso de que no estemos seguros si fastboot permite saltarse las restricciones que impone un gestor de arranque bloqueado, también tenemos en el Capítulo 13: Actualizaciones del sistema y Acceso Root (en la sección Gestor de Arranque, subsección Modo Fastboot):

Comandos que modifican las particiones del dispositivo, como las diversas variaciones de flash, y comandos que arrancan núcleos personalizados, como el comando de arranque, no están permitidos cuando el gestor de arranque está bloqueado.

PreguntAndroid.com

PreguntAndroid es una comunidad de usuarios de Android en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X